South Africa – Two Views of the Real Estate Market
“The Economist” magazine recently named the South Africa real estate market as the world’s best-performing housing market in the longer term. The magazine maintains a global house price index, and that shows a cumulative 418% rise in South Africa real estate prices over the last 12 years (2007-2009). The magazine tracks 20 other housing markets, and none have shown that level of performance.

Buy to Let Property Market Beginning to Recover
For buy to let property investors in the UK, the third quarter of 2009 may come to mark an important turning point in a market that has been badly hurt by a slump in property prices and the freezing of residential mortgage markets. According to data compiled by Britain’s Council of Mortgage Lenders, the volume of buy to let mortgages increased for the first time in that quarter since the end of 2007.
